In 3.5, creating a tileset from individual object PNGs was easy. Create a scene, import the PNG files, then go to Menu > Scene > Convert to... > Tileset.
In 4.1.1 I quite frankly still have not figured out how to produce a useful result. Ok, I need to get good. I understand that, but it's so difficult that I cannot figure it out even when following the directions. I have been begging for someone on discord to help, but no one else seems to know how either.
Therefore; I understand the process needed to be improved, but does it have to be so difficult that it can't be completed by following the documentation alone? ( that is....reading the documentation as a new user, not as an experienced user ).
